"Usually " all new plastic is sold black and you have to use vinyl dye to match .
As far as Grahite goes in 3rd gens , they did have that color in the 82-84 years . 85-92 the only gray shades were Medium and light gray . Your best bet would be searching boneyards for 82-84's or using the vinyl dye . I re-sprayed all my panels just so they look new again . I used high quality vinyl dye from a paint shop and I did prime the panels first . That was a 1.5 years ago and they still look as good as the day I did it . Make sure you specify Satin dye , that way it will have a factory finish . I goofed the first time and bought gloss....yik

hey,

just a word of caution. I put the interior out of an '89 Iroc in my '83. The placement of the front seatbelt anchor points changed somewhere along the line. You will run into trouble mounting the sill plates if you use the pieces from an '83 (until what year, I'm not sure yet). just my $.02
